Web31 mrt. 2024 · India currently aims to install 500 GW of renewable energy capacity, including large hydro, by 2030. This will largely be dominated by solar power sector with a share of 300 GW; the wind power sector will account for 140 GW. Web10 apr. 2024 · The report says India will have a notable presence in all upstream components of PV manufacturing. It claims that cell capacity will reach 59 GW by fiscal 2026, ingot/wafer capacity will hit 56 GW, and polysilicon will touch 38 GW.
